Performance Exhaust

I am not real knowldegeable on this subject. Does a performance exhaust enhance gas mileage? I was thinking of a cat back system or dual exhaust. If it does, which is preferred for a 1999, F150 with 5.4L? The application would be for daily driving not competition. I understand there might be conflicting opinions on this. I put true duals on my 97, 4.6 and on my 07 5.4. Didn't do a whole lot for the 97 but the 07 liked it. MPG may go up a lil but the fun factor is a lot better. Since there are already dual cats just cut out the Y and dual it from there.
